html {
    display: table;
    width: 100%;
    height: 100%;
 }

body { 
    color: #333333; 
    font-size: 13px;
    font-family: Verdana;
    display: table-cell;
    width: 100%;
    height: 100%;
    /*vertical-align: middle;*/
    text-align: center;
    margin: 0px; 
}

.out {
    margin: 0px;
    /*margin-top: -10%;*/
    width: 100%;
}

.content {
    text-align: center;
}

a:link {
    color: #333333;
    text-decoration: none;
}

a:active {
    color: #333333;
    text-decoration: none;
}

a:visited {
    color: #333333;
    text-decoration: none;
}


a:hover {
    color: #007dbe;
    text-decoration: none;
}

.a_konami:link {
    color: #333333;
    text-decoration: none;
}

.a_konami:active {
    color: #333333;
    text-decoration: none;
}

.a_konami:visited {
    color: #333333;
    text-decoration: none;
}

.a_konami:hover {
    color: #F98B39;
    text-decoration: none;
}

#projekteDiv {
    position: absolute;
    left: 40%;
    margin: 10px;
    padding: 10px;
    border: 1px solid #cccccc;
    color: #333333;
    width: 320px;
    text-align: left;
}

#kontaktDiv {
    position: absolute;
    left: 40%;
    margin: 10px;
    padding: 10px;
    border: 1px solid #cccccc;
    color: #333333;
    width: 320px;
    text-align: left;
}

#kontaktResultDiv {
    position: absolute;
    left: 40%;
    margin: 10px;
    padding: 10px;
    border: 1px solid #cccccc;
    color: #333333;
    width: 300px;
    text-align: left;
}

#info {
    text-decoration: underline;
}

#tooltip {
    position: absolute;
    top: 0px;
    left: 0px;
    border: 1px solid #cccccc;
    padding: 10px;
    width: 150px;
}

input {
    border: 1px solid #cccccc;
    color: #333333;
    width: 90%;
    padding: 4px;
}

input:focus {
    border: 1px solid #007dbe;
    color: #333333;
    width: 90%;
    padding: 4px;
}

input:hover {
    border: 1px solid #007dbe;
    color: #333333;
    width: 90%;
    padding: 4px;
}

input.konami:focus {
    border: 1px solid #F98B39;
    color: #333333;
    width: 90%;
    padding: 4px;
}

input.konami:hover {
    border: 1px solid #F98B39;
    color: #333333;
    width: 90%;
    padding: 4px;
}

input.buttonSend {
    border: 1px solid #cccccc;
    color: #333333;
    width: 95%;
    padding: 4px;
}

input.buttonSend:focus {
    border: 1px solid #007dbe;
    color: #333333;
    width: 95%;
    padding: 4px;
}

input.buttonSend:hover {
    border: 1px solid #007dbe;
    color: #333333;
    width: 95%;
    padding: 4px;
}

select {
    border: 1px solid #cccccc;
    color: #333333;
    width: 95%;
    padding: 4px;
}

select:focus {
    border: 1px solid #007dbe;
    color: #333333;
    width: 95%;
    padding: 4px;
}

select:hover {
    border: 1px solid #007dbe;
    color: #333333;
    width: 95%;
    padding: 4px;
}

select.konami:focus, select.konami:hover {
border: 1px solid #F98B39;
    color: #333333;
    width: 95%;
    padding: 4px;
}

textarea {
    border: 1px solid #cccccc;
    color: #333333;
    width: 90%;
    padding: 4px;
    height: 150px;
}

textarea:focus {
    border: 1px solid #007dbe;
    color: #333333;
    width: 90%;
    padding: 4px;
}

textarea:hover {
    border: 1px solid #007dbe;
    color: #333333;
    width: 90%;
    padding: 4px;
}

textarea.konami:focus, textarea.konami:hover {
    border: 1px solid #F98B39;
    color: #333333;
    width: 90%;
    padding: 4px;
}
